在区块链技术迅猛发展的今天,数字货币逐渐受到用户的重视,尤其是稳定币USDT(Tether),成为了许多投资者和交易...
在比特币的世界中,钱包和公钥的概念往往是新手用户面临的复杂问题之一。比特币是分散的数字货币,其交易通过加密技术来确保安全,而公钥就是这一技术框架的重要组成部分。公钥不仅用于发送和接收比特币,也决定了钱包的安全性和匿名性。
首先,让我们定义一下公钥。公钥是数位货币技术中用来接收交易的地址之一,通常与私钥(用户用来签署交易的秘密信息)成对出现。公钥是公开的,任何人都可以用它向用户发送比特币。不同于私钥,公钥不需要保密,但获取公钥的方式通常是通过用户的钱包生成。每一个比特币钱包至少有一个公钥,但实际上,可以生成数量几乎无限的公钥。
比特币钱包可以生成数量极为庞大的公钥。实际上,只要你的钱包软件支持,它可以生成多个公钥供用户使用。这是因为每个钱包都基于一个种子(seed),每次基于这种子生成公钥都会产生不同的结果。通过变换这个种子,也可以生成几乎无限的公钥,因此可以说一个比特币钱包都可以有数以百万计乃至数十亿计的公钥。
在去中心化的加密货币系统中,私钥和公钥的关系至关重要。用户必须保密他们的私钥,因为一旦私钥被他人获得,他们就可以控制钱包中的比特币。公钥的使用则透明且开放,因此它通常被视为用户地址,可以安全地用于交易和转账。
使用公钥进行交易的一个显著优点是它提供了某种形式的匿名性。尽管所有交易都是公开和可追踪的,但交易方可以选择不透露其身份。通过使用不同的公钥,用户可以在不同的交易中保持他们的钱包和身份的分离。然而,随着被监控技术的提高(如链上分析),全匿名性的维持变得愈发困难。
举个例子,用户如果想在网上购买某个商品,他们可以生成一个唯一的公钥,用于该交易。该公钥会与商品的购买信息一起发送到商家,商家通过公钥可以发送比特币回到用户的地址。这种方法确保用户的私钥不会被暴露,从而大大提高了交易的安全性。
比特币钱包的公钥数量几乎是无限的,基于生成种子的算法设计,允许钱包生成多个、甚至数十亿个唯一的公钥。这为用户提供了灵活性和安全性选项。
2.虽然公钥可以公开,但用户应该选择在不同的交易中使用不同的公钥,以增加隐私保护。在生成时不要轻易分享与他人,并保持对钱包的保护,以防被盗。
3.虽然公钥和钱包地址经常被混淆,实际上,地址是对公钥的哈希处理,是用来接收比特币的,而公钥是用来解锁比特币的。地址的使用使用户更容易在交易中共享和转账。
4.不可能从公钥反推私钥,这正是公钥密码学的基础。私钥通过复杂的数学算法生成,与公钥是不可逆的,从而确保了比特币交易的安全性。
5.是的,只要用户保管好自己的私钥,使用公钥进行交易是相对安全的。但在选择公钥进行交易时,应避免重复使用相同的公钥,以保护用户隐私。
6.公钥的泄露本身不会导致比特币被盗,但如果用户在多个交易中使用同一公钥,可能会导致他们的交易模式被跟踪。因此,加强对公钥的管理对于保护用户隐私极为重要。
综上所述,比特币钱包的公钥是整个交易系统的基石之一,对保障用户的安全性和匿名性至关重要。了解公钥的数量、生成与管理,将使用户在使用比特币时获得更好的体验。